Alternatives to the behavior charts

Schools have many strategies to handle unacceptable behaviour. Behavior charts are a method that has been in use for a long time. They serve as a form of reinforcement. They can be used to help kids improve their self-control.

The ability to monitor the behavior of students is the main reason to use behavior charts for teachers. They can be beneficial for some kids but not all kids.

They’re a popular tool to teach young children. Many parents utilize these to inspire their children to do well in the classroom. Teachers might also use them as a way to acknowledge students’ extraordinary behavior.

Many people are unsure if it’s worth keeping these around. In spite of their widespread use, there are more advantageous and less harmful alternatives.

One approach to Positive Behavioral Intervention involves Support. This method teaches children how to avoid wrongdoing instead of scolding them for their actions. It’s based on real life relationships that teaches students how to best support one another in moments of intense emotion.

You can also use behavior cards or chore charts. Certain children may be motivated more by bigger prizes. Younger children may be more motivated by tokens.
